如何安全有效地查询VPN地址,网络工程师的实用指南
在当今高度互联的数字世界中,虚拟私人网络(VPN)已成为个人用户和企业保障隐私、绕过地理限制以及提升网络安全的重要工具,许多用户在使用过程中常遇到一个问题:“怎么查VPN地址?”这不仅关系到连接是否成功,更涉及网络安全和合规性问题,作为一名经验丰富的网络工程师,我将从技术原理、常见方法和注意事项三个方面,为你提供一份清晰、实用的指南。
我们要明确“VPN地址”指的是什么,通常它有两层含义:一是你当前使用的VPN服务提供商分配给你的虚拟IP地址(即客户端端口映射后的公网IP),二是该服务背后的服务器实际物理位置或IP段,这两种信息对不同场景意义不同:普通用户关心的是自己的“虚拟IP”,而IT管理员可能需要知道后端服务器地址以进行策略配置或故障排查。
查看当前连接的VPN地址(客户端视角)
如果你已经连接了某个VPN服务(如ExpressVPN、NordVPN、OpenVPN等),可以通过以下方式查看你的“虚拟IP地址”:
-
命令行工具(推荐)
- Windows系统:打开命令提示符(cmd),输入
ipconfig,找到“PPP适配器”部分,其中显示的IPv4地址就是你的VPN地址。 - macOS/Linux:终端输入
ifconfig或ip addr show,查找与VPN接口相关的网卡(如 tun0、tap0),其IP即为当前虚拟地址。
- Windows系统:打开命令提示符(cmd),输入
-
网页检测工具
访问像 whatismyipaddress.com 或 ipleak.net 这类网站,它们会自动识别你当前公网IP,如果这个IP与你本地ISP分配的IP不同,说明你已通过VPN接入,且该IP即为VPN地址。 -
第三方工具
使用像Wireshark这样的抓包工具,可以捕获你连接时的数据包,从中提取出目标服务器的IP地址(通常是加密隧道的终点)。
查询特定VPN服务商的服务器地址(高级用法)
如果你是企业IT人员或高级用户,想了解某家VPN服务商的服务器分布,可采用如下方法:
- 查阅官方文档或API:多数主流VPN服务提供公开的服务器列表(如ProtonVPN的“Server List”页面),这些地址通常以域名形式存在,可通过DNS解析获得真实IP。
- 使用nslookup或dig命令:在终端输入
nslookup your-vpn-service.com,即可获取其A记录(即服务器IP)。 - 爬虫分析(需合法授权):一些开源项目如“VPNGate”会聚合全球免费VPN节点数据,可用于研究目的。
重要提醒与安全建议
- 不要随意相信“匿名”宣称:某些非法或非正规的“免费VPN”可能记录并泄露你的IP地址,务必选择信誉良好的服务。
- 避免暴露真实IP:在公共Wi-Fi下使用VPN时,若未正确配置路由规则,可能仍会泄露本地IP,应启用“kill switch”功能。
- 合规性检查:在某些国家或地区(如中国、俄罗斯等),未经许可的VPN使用可能违法,请遵守当地法律法规。
“查VPN地址”不是一件复杂的事,但背后隐藏着网络安全逻辑,掌握这些技巧,不仅能帮你确认连接状态,还能提升整体网络防护意识,作为网络工程师,我们始终强调:透明、可控、安全——这才是现代数字生活的基础。




